We are Yes for Wenatchee Schools, a volunteer Political Action Committee (PAC) formed by local parents, alumni, business leaders, and community members. We are NOT the Wenatchee School District. We use private funds and volunteer time to advocate for the best facilities for our students.
What We’re Doing Now
Our purpose in this pre-campaign phase is to:
- Listen: Gather feedback on community willingness to support a Capital Bond addressing critical facility needs, including WHS utilization (104%) and aging mechanical systems.
- Inform: Share objective facts about the facility study and the financial reality: the proposed $295 Million Bond leverages up to $79 Million in State Matching Funds (SCAP).
- Organize: Build a team of dedicated volunteers to prepare for the upcoming election date and ensure timely action to mitigate escalating construction costs.
Why Your Involvement Matters
A bond is a massive investment and requires a 60% supermajority. This level of support can only happen when thousands of neighbors talk to neighbors. We need you to help lay the foundation for a successful vote for the construction of a new WHS, which was rated “Poor” in physical condition (score of 49.65), and district-wide HVAC upgrades to address failing and outdated systems.
